Job Description

Quality Engineer,
Swansea, Monday Friday days
£35,000 -£38,000

Are you an experienced Quality Engineer seeking an exciting opportunity to make a significant impact in a manufacturing environment? We are currently seeking a highly skilled and motivated individual to join our clients team in Swansea. As a Quality Engineer, you will work closely with the Production team to establish and maintain our quality system for production, packaging, assembly, and warehouse activities.


Quality Engineer- Main Duties

  • Develop and maintain quality instructions, specifications, and standards.
  • Collaborate with the purchasing team to establish quality requirements for suppliers and drive quality improvements.
  • Conduct goods inwards checks and inspect critical components for quality.
  • Support quality training and mentor production staff.
  • Conduct audits of the production quality system.
  • Investigate non-conformance and implement corrective and preventive actions.
  • Manage shipping release and customer returns processes.
  • Ensure effective control of non-conforming items.
  • Maintain records and analyze data to drive quality improvement.

What are we looking for in you?


  • Experienced in managing quality in a manufacturing environment.
  • HNC/HND or equivalent in Electrical/Electronic and/or Mechanical Engineering.
  • Good understanding of GMP (Good Manufacturing Practices).
  • Experience in electronic product or medical device assembly is desirable.
  • Working knowledge of ISO 13485 is desirable.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Ability to evaluate complex data and provide clear, actionable insights.
  • Constructively challenge issues and provide training and support for improvement.
